Is it hard to be a sewing machine operator?

Being a sewing machine operator involves learning how to operate sewing machines, follow patterns, and ensure quality control, which can require attention to detail and manual dexterity. The job often involves repetitive tasks and working in a fast-paced environment, but with training and experience, it becomes easier to perform efficiently.

What is the hourly rate for sewing?

The hourly rate for a sewing machine operator typically ranges from $10 to $20 per hour, depending on experience, location, and the employer. Entry-level positions may pay closer to the lower end, while experienced operators or those working in specialized environments can earn higher wages.

Workwear Outfitters has a strong legacy of building innovative and authentic market-right products and is a leading supplier of work apparel and footwear for diverse occupations in industries such as automotive, manufacturing, oil and gas, utilities, government, food services, telecommunications, hospitality, and many more. Workwear Outfitters is based in Nashville, Tennessee with over $800 million in sales and we employ more than 5,800 people in facilities spanning the globe.
Brands under the Workwear Outfitters umbrella include Red Kap, Bulwark, Image Authority, Kodiak, Terra, Walls, Liberty , Work Authority, Workrite Fire Service, Chef Designs, and Horace Small. Workwear Outfitters is also the exclusive licensee for Dickies apparel in the B2B channel.
